The High Commission of Sri Lanka in Islamabad is the diplomatic mission of Sri Lanka to Pakistan.[1] The high commission is also accredited to Kyrgyzstan and Tajikistan.[1] The current high commissioner is Air Chief Marshal Jayalath Weerakkody, the former Commander of the Sri Lanka Air Force.[2][3]
